**FAQ: Cleaning-crew access**

Q: Who lets the cleaners in?

A: You don't. Vexley Services has its own schedule — weeknights 19:00–22:00, plus Saturday mornings. They hold their own fobs for main doors. Exception: the third-floor studio at Corbray House, which is keypad-only. If you're last out and a cleaner is waiting there, you may admit them after checking their Vexley lanyard. Log it in the access book by the door. The studio keypad code is:

turnstile pass: bdg-QZV-3

Re: export worker heap growth — the problem is we materialize every row of the workbook before streaming, so large Tallygrid exports hold the whole sheet in memory. I switched to chunked row flushing with a bounded cell cache, which keeps the resident set flat regardless of sheet size. Tests pass, and peak usage on the big fixture dropped by roughly 80%. The chunking behavior is controlled by the constants below.

tuning table, kajog-kawef:
PRIORITIES = {
    "kelox": 870,
    "kasix": 89,
    "eliax": 988,
}

### Runbook: Restarting the Givenroot receipt mailer

When donors report missing receipts, first check the Givenroot mailer queue depth via the admin panel; anything above 500 means the worker has stalled. Restart it with `systemctl restart givenroot-mailer`, then confirm `GR_SMTP_HOST` and `GR_FROM_NAME` are populated in `/etc/givenroot/mailer.env`.

If the worker logs an authentication failure on startup, the mail relay credential is missing. Re-add it on the following line:

env line for fafof-fahag: LEDGER_TOKEN5=f8790

Welcome to the Harbordesk support team. Our internal wiki, Quillbase, uses role-based access: agents get read access to all runbooks, while edit rights are limited to leads. Role sync runs hourly against the Lanternview directory, so new accounts may take up to an hour to appear. The wiki bot needs its own service credential to perform the sync. Add the following line to the bot's env file.

env line for bahip-baguf: LEDGER_TOKEN8=27066bbf